The much-anticipated Hyundai Venue 2025 is all set to hit Indian roads on November 4, 2025, with a starting price around Rs. 8 lakh. This new-generation Venue promises a significant upgrade in design, features, and technology, aiming to strengthen its position in the highly competitive subcompact SUV segment.
Bold New Design and Stylish Looks
The 2025 Venue features a thoroughly revised exterior that aligns with Hyundai’s latest family design language, exhibiting a bold front grille, sleek LED headlamps, and sporty 16-inch alloy wheels. The overall aesthetics are more modern and aggressive, giving it a fresh appeal for urban buyers. Spy shots of the upcoming model suggest a premium and aerodynamic silhouette that enhances road presence.

Advanced Dual 12.3-inch Screens and Enhanced Technology
One of the standout highlights is the inclusion of large dual 12.3-inch screens, surpassing the current 10.25-inch displays found in Hyundai’s Creta and Alcazar models. These screens comprise a digital instrument cluster and a touchscreen infotainment system. Safety Features and Driver Assistance
The 2025 Venue takes a leap forward in safety with a new level-2 Advanced Driver Assistance System (ADAS) borrowed from Hyundai’s premium siblings. It is expected to include features like front parking sensors, a 360-degree camera, six airbags, ABS with EBD, electronic stability control, and a tyre pressure monitoring system. This makes the Venue one of the safer options in its segment.

Comfortable and Convenient Interiors
Hyundai is expected to equip the Venue with premium features such as dual-zone automatic climate control, ventilated front seats, a panoramic sunroof, a powered driver seat, keyless entry with push-button start, and cruise control. Efficient Powertrain Options
The 2025 Venue likely retains similar engine options as the current model, including a 1.0-liter turbocharged petrol engine producing around 120 PS and paired with a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ission. The petrol variant with a 5-speed manual transmission and the possibility of an automatic diesel option are also expected. These powertrains offer a balanced mix of performance, fuel efficiency, and smooth driving dynamics suitable for both city traffic and highway cruising.
Competitive Pricing and Market Position
Priced starting around Rs. 8 lakh (ex-showroom), the Hyundai Venue 2025 will compete head-on with popular rivals like the Maruti Suzuki Brezza, Tata Nexon, Kia Sonet, and Mahindra XUV 3OO among others. Its premium features, advanced technology, and safety credentials give it an edge to attract buyers looking for value-packed, stylish subcompact SUVs.
